leg中文什么意思
n.
1.腿;(猪、羊等)供食用的腿。
2.(桌椅等的)腿脚;支架;支柱;支管。
3.三角形底部以外的侧边。

- a leg: 一条腿
- leg it: 徒步 跑, 快走
- leg and leg: 双方得分相等, 平分秋色
例句与用法
更多例句: 下一页- The accident left a scar on her leg .
那次事故后她的腿上留下了伤疤。 - Karen's right leg was crossed over her left .
凯伦的右腿架在左腿上。 - She went out to stretch her legs after lunch .
她午饭后出去散步了。 - We'd better shade a leg or we'll be late .
我们最好快些,否则会迟到。 - The poor old horse is on its last legs .
那匹可怜的老马已经奄奄一息。
